Epsom Downs to Ealing Broadway by train

A train trip from Epsom Downs to Ealing Broadway takes about 1hrs 55 mins on average, covering roughly 13 miles (21 kilometres). With around 35 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£12.70,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Epsom Downs to Ealing Broadway are available for £12.70 one way, or £22.40 return

Station Facilities and Travel Assistance

Epsom Downs station, though lacking a ticket office, is equipped with ticket machines where you can collect your tickets, especially if you've booked online. These machines are designed to be accessible, offering facilities for those with a Disabled Persons Railcard. While the station does not boast an indoor waiting room or seating areas, it provides step-free access across all platforms, categorized as a Category A station. This ensures ease of mobility for everyone, particularly those with accessibility needs.

For customer assistance, the station is equipped with help points, and if you require further help, assistance can be pre-arranged. Although there are no dedicated staff rooms, assistance is generally available via mobile teams. Keep in mind, Epsom Downs doesn’t offer amenities like toilets or refreshments, so it’s advised to plan accordingly.

Station Facilities and Amenities

Ealing Broadway station is adeptly equipped to handle the daily throng of passengers, offering a range of facilities to enhance the commuter experience. The station boasts ticket offices open from early morning until late at night, ensuring you can purchase and collect your rail tickets with ease. For those who prefer the convenience of technology, ticket machines are accessible and intuitive, even for individuals with any mobility or sensory needs. The station is designed with inclusivity in mind, reflected in its step-free access and staff assistance throughout.

Need Help? We've Got You Covered

Customer service is a priority at Ealing Broadway. A dedicated help point and proactive ticket office staff ensure you have all the guidance you need. Concerns about luggage? While there's no baggage storage, the ever-watchful CCTV secures your peace of mind as you journey through. Toilets and baby changing facilities are easily accessible on the concourse, making it a family-friendly stop for travelers of all ages.

Effortless Travel Connections

Beyond the tracks, Ealing Broadway provides seamless connectivity to multiple forms of transportation. You can easily hop on a Transport for London bus right outside the station or slide into the tunnels of the London Underground via the Central and District Lines. For those jetting off to further destinations, the Elizabeth Line offers a direct route to Heathrow Airport, simplifying your travel plans.

Want to explore the city on two wheels? Bicycle hire services such as Brompton Dock are conveniently available, ensuring that you enjoy your journey sustainably. Although there are no bicycle storage spaces or sheltered parking at the station, cycling enthusiasts will find ample ways to navigate the cityscape.
